What is DXF?

DXF, or Drawing Exchange Format, is a file format used for 2D and 3D computer-aided design (CAD) drawings. It was developed by Autodesk in 1982 and has since become a widely adopted standard across the industry.

One of the primary advantages of DXF Files Free is their compatibility with various CAD software programs. This means that designers can create designs using their preferred software and then easily share them with others who may be using different programs.

DXF also provides an efficient way to store complex designs by representing them as vector graphics rather than bitmaps. This allows for precise scaling without loss of quality or detail.

Another significant advantage of DXF files is their use in CNC manufacturing. With these files, manufacturers can automate the production process by creating instructions for CNC machines to follow in order to produce accurate parts with minimal human intervention.

How to Use Free DXF Files for CNC Manufacturing

Using free DXF files for CNC manufacturing is a great way to streamline the production process and ensure accuracy in cutting and shaping. But how do you actually use these files?

First, make sure your CNC machine is compatible with DXF files. Most modern machines should be able to read them, but it's always good to double-check. Next, import the file into your CAM software and set up the toolpaths according to your desired specifications.

Before starting the actual cutting process, it's important to perform test runs on scrap materials to ensure everything is working correctly. Once you're confident in the setup, begin cutting using the parameters established in your CAM software.

Throughout the process, keep an eye on any potential errors or issues that may arise. It's important to monitor progress regularly and adjust as needed for optimal results.
